Fundamentals of System Design - Sesson 1 of 3


Details
In this 3-week series, explore the fascinating world of system design from the ground up. Whether you're an aspiring software engineer, a data enthusiast, or a seasoned professional seeking to refine your knowledge, these sessions are tailored to help you master key concepts, tackle real-world challenges, and excel in system design interviews. Each week builds on the previous, taking you through the fundamentals, advanced topics, and specialized design considerations for data engineering.
Event Description:
Kickstart your journey into system design with this foundational session. Whether you’re a beginner or want to revisit the basics, this session will cover everything you need to build a strong base. Learn key concepts and techniques engineers use to design scalable and efficient systems.
What You’ll Learn:
- The principles of system design and its importance in software engineering.
- Key concepts like replication, load balancing, and caching to enhance system performance.
- How to document and visualize designs using industry-standard tools.
- Apply what you learn in a basic system design activity.
Join us for an interactive and hands-on session to understand the building blocks of system design.

Fundamentals of System Design - Sesson 1 of 3